Artist Crafts an Anamorphic Portrait of Martin Luther King Using Shoes of All Colors, Shapes and Sizes

Artist Noah Scalin of Skull-A-Day fame has created another one of his amazing anamorphic portraits, this time using shoes of all colors, shapes and sizes to form a befitting portrait of the great Martin Luther King. The portrait was made for a People's Light production of "The Mountaintop", which runs from September 28 - October 30, 2016 at their Malvern, Pennsylvania theater.
